The SAWS reports several unbelievable rainfall totals in the 24 hours to 8am on Tues 12th. Highest include:
Margate 311mm, Mt Edgecombe 307mm, Pennington South 307mm, Virginia (old airport) 304mm, KS Airport 225mm, Port Edward 188mm, etc.
